On August 27, 2008, Rage Against the Machine played to an estimated crowd of 9,000 at the Denver Coliseum during the Democratic National Convention, which was being held at the nearby Pepsi Center. Protesting the Iraq War, the group performed such well-known staples as "Bulls on Parade" and "Killing in the Name" before joining an antiwar march lead by Iraq Veterans Against the War.
